DMTK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

21 of the 4,373 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in DermTech, Inc. Common Stock (DMTK)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$109M — up 23% from $89.1M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new DMTK posit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Polar Asset Management Partners, adding an estimated $14.7M. The largest seller was Boothbay Fund Management, cutting an estimated $5.39M.
